如何生成随机比特币钱包地址?全面解析比特币
比特币(Bitcoin)作为一种去中心化的数字货币,自2009年由中本聪(Satoshi Nakamoto)发布以来,逐渐在全球范围内受到广泛关注。比特币的优势不仅在于其去中心化特性,还有便捷的跨境交易、高度的隐私保护以及相对较低的交易成本。而比特币交易的核心操作离不开“钱包”和“钱包地址”。在此背景下,本文将重点介绍如何生成随机比特币钱包地址,并对比特币钱包及其相关概念进行深入探讨。
比特币钱包是什么?
比特币钱包是一种用于存储、发送和接收比特币的工具。虽然比特币本身是一种数字货币,但这些货币的存储和管理却依靠钱包软件或硬件。比特币钱包并不像传统的钱包那样存储“法币”,而是通过公钥和私钥的形式来进行比特币的管理。公钥相当于钱包地址,可以与他人分享以接收比特币;而私钥则是用于签署交易的关键,必须保密,任何获取私钥的人都有权利完全控制该钱包里的比特币。
比特币钱包的类型
比特币钱包主要分为以下几种类型:
- 纸钱包:纸钱包就是将比特币的公钥和私钥打印在纸上,属于一种离线存储,安全性强,但容易遗失或损坏。
- 软件钱包:软件钱包又分为桌面钱包和移动钱包。桌面钱包安装在PC电脑上,安全性相对较高;而移动钱包则是应用在手机上的,使用方便且便于随时进行交易。
- 硬件钱包:硬件钱包如Ledger和Trezor等,是专门用于存储加密货币的设备,它将私钥储存于硬件中,极大提高了安全性。
- 在线钱包:在线钱包是以云存储技术为基础的,通过互联网访问,便利性高,缺点是安全性相对较低,容易受到黑客攻击。
随机生成比特币钱包地址的底层原理
比特币地址是一串由字母和数字组成的字符串,它是通过公钥生成的。公钥则是通过私钥进行椭圆曲线数字签名算法(ECDSA)生成的。在生成钱包地址时,使用 SHA-256 哈希函数对私钥进行哈希运算,再经过 RIPEMD-160 哈希生成公钥。最后,通过 Base58Check 编码的方法将最终的地址转换为用户可以识别的字符串。
随机生成比特币钱包地址的过程可以概述为:首先,生成随机数作为私钥,这是比特币安全性的重要基础。然后利用私钥生成公钥,再从公钥生成最终的比特币钱包地址。生成的钱包地址是具有一定复杂性和随机性的,这也为用户提供了一定程度的安全保障。
比特币钱包地址的安全性
由于比特币交易是不可逆的,一旦发送到错误的钱包地址或者被黑客盗用,资金将会面临失去的风险。因此,确保比特币钱包地址的安全性是至关重要的。以下是一些保障钱包安全的常见策略:
- 保护私钥:私钥是访问比特币钱包的唯一钥匙,务必妥善保存,切勿共享。
- 启用两步验证:很多钱包服务支持两步验证,增加了安全层级,有效防护用户账户。
- 定期备份钱包:保证拥有钱包的备份,可以防止数据丢失导致的资金损失。
- 选择信誉良好的钱包服务:使用经过验证和审计的钱包软件,能减少被攻击的风险。
相关问题探讨
1. 如何安全地存储比特币钱包的私钥?
比特币钱包的私钥是用户获得比特币及进行交易的关键,要保证其安全存储。首先,可以将私钥打印成纸质格式,形成“纸钱包”,并放在安全的地方。其次,使用加密技术对私钥进行保护,避免未经授权的访问。同时,尽量不要将私钥储存在联网的设备中,因为这会增加私钥被窃取的风险。定期备份私钥,对于长时间不动的钱包,建议在不同地点进行多次备份,用于防止因意外损坏导致的丢失。
2. 生成随机比特币钱包地址是否完全安全?
生成随机比特币钱包地址的过程本质上是安全的,因为它基于强大的随机数生成算法和哈希函数。然而,如果生成随机数的源头不安全(例如,使用低质量的随机数生成器),那么这种钱包地址也可能失去安全性。因此,建议使用验证过的库和工具来生成随机数,以确保安全性。同时,用户应当定期更换钱包地址,尤其在接收大额比特币时,增加安全隐患的难度。
3. 怎样识别一个比特币钱包地址是否安全?
要判断一个比特币钱包地址是否安全,首先需要确认钱包提供服务的可靠性。用户可以查看该钱包的评价、讨论和安全审计是否可信。此外,用户应当查看是否提供了私钥、助记词保护、以及是否支持两步验证等安全功能。此外,定期更新软件、关注网络安全信息和实施钱包隔离也都是确保钱包地址安全的有效手段。
4. 使用不同的钱包地址的好处是什么?
使用不同比特币钱包地址的主要好处在于提高隐私性和安全性。很多交易所与服务提供商会记录用户的交易历史,使用多个地址可以有效减少用户交易行为被跟踪的概率。此外,每个地址都是独立的,一旦某一地址被攻击或泄露,用户的其他资产依然安全。这样也可以防止外部用户通过分析链上数据了解用户的整体资产状况。
5. 如何对比特币钱包地址进行管理?
对比特币钱包地址进行管理可以通过以下几种方法来实现:首先,使用可靠的钱包软件,这些软件通常提供资产管理功能;其次,确保钱包地址的有序命名,以便于在进行转账或接收时可以快速识别。用户亦可以使用电子表格记录不同钱包地址及其用途,以方便管理。此外,定期对钱包进行审计,查看是否有未使用的地址、老旧地址等,以维护钱包的健康性。
总结而言,比特币钱包和钱包地址是数字货币领域的基础结构,通过生成随机钱包地址,用户能够更安全地管理和使用比特币。了解这些相关概念和提高自己的安全意识,将极大提升用户的比特币交易体验。
``` 此次内容深入讨论了比特币钱包地址的生成原理、钱包的安全性及其管理方式,同时对用户常见的相关问题进行了详细解答。希望这能帮助用户更好地理解和使用比特币。